About agriculture in Bairnsdale

Located in the East Gippsland region of Victoria, Bairnsdale serves as a major regional hub situated on the banks of the Mitchell River. The surrounding landscape is characterized by fertile river flats and the scenic Gippsland Lakes to the south, while the northern horizon is dominated by the foothills of the Great Dividing Range.

The area is renowned for its diverse agricultural sector, driven by high-quality soils and reliable rainfall. Local farming focuses heavily on dairy production and beef cattle grazing, alongside significant vegetable cultivation on the rich alluvial plains of the Mitchell River valley. Horticulture, including crops like broccoli and lettuce, plays a vital role in the regional economy.

For agronomists and seasonal workers, Bairnsdale offers year-round opportunities due to its mix of livestock and intensive cropping. Peak demand often coincides with vegetable harvests and the busy spring calving season. Workers can expect a well-developed agricultural infrastructure with numerous support services and farm supply outlets located within the town.
